Shared Hosting and Dedicated Hosting – Choosing Between These Two
When it comes to hosting your website with a web hosting company, there are various options. Yes, you can choose between shared hosting, VPS hosting, and dedicated hosting. While both shared and dedicated hosting can host all your files on a single server, there are several differences in how these services are handled, their performance, etc. It is always good to go through some hosting reviews of companies like SiteGround, Bluehost, HostGator, etc., before taking a final decision.
This article will look at two types of hosting and the major differences in choosing between them.
What is Shared Hosting?
Shared hosting is something similar to renting a house in an apartment building. Even though you have separate home, there are many houses located inside the apartment building. Water connection, electricity, and other services are common for the whole building. In the same way, shared hosting is about hosting your website on a server that hosts more than 2-3 websites. As the name suggests, the hosting server is shared by many clients. One of the main reasons people opt for shared hosting is that they are less expensive than dedicated hosting. But it has its own advantages and disadvantages.
What is Dedicated Hosting?
If you are looking for a trouble-free hosting experience, then you need to go for dedicated hosting. In simple words, dedicated hosting means you will be dedicated to a web server only for the sole purpose of hosting your website files. Hence, you could gain premium performance as the resources are not shared with other clients.
Differences Between Shared Hosting and Dedicated Hosting
If you think of shared hosting as public transportation, dedicated hosting is like traveling in a rented car all by yourself. With public transportation, you don’t have control over the number of stops, speed, music it plays, etc. But with a rented car, you have complete control of where to stop, what music is played, and travel at your own speed. Let’s take a look at how both these types of hosting stack up against each other concerning certain factors as explained below and help you find a perfect hosting solution for your business.
Customization & Flexibility
When it comes to customizing the server, it is often not possible with shared hosting. Since the server is shared with multiple clients/websites, any changes done will also impact others. While some allow for having extended storage or additional FTP users, beyond that, customization with shared hosting is a big question.
With dedicated hosting, you are in complete control of the server. Since it is not shared with anyone, you are free to install the required software, tools, and utilities and configure the environment to your liking.
One of the major drawbacks of shared hosting is frequent slowdowns and downtimes. There could be many reasons behind the slowdown, as other websites could have huge traffic and use up the server’s processing power more. Faulty coding and server crashing down due to other issues can create a slowdown on the server. Large enterprises with high traffic volumes generally prefer dedicated hosting as it is reliable and withstand extreme traffic. If you need more processing power, you can increase it as well.
When it comes to security, hosting your website with shared hosting servers will increase cyberattacks’ chances. Since the server is common for hundreds of other clients, there is every possibility of a security breach. If you are concerned about security, then you should definitely go for dedicated hosting. With dedicated hosting, you can install all the needed security and software to protect your server against cyberattacks.
Another major drawback of shared hosting is that they are not scalable. Even though some shared hosting providers offer scalable bandwidth, it is not the case with everyone. Hence, if you see increased traffic to your website and scale it up, it could be a problem with this type of hosting. You need to either move your files to another server with more resources and bandwidth or opt for dedicated hosting.
On the other hand, dedicated hosting is highly scalable as you have complete control over the server. Hence, you can install or increase any resources you need to scale your website.
When it comes to the hosting cost factor, shared hosting could be the clear winner. If you are just a startup company or hosting your personal portfolio, you can always go for this hosting. Generally, shared hosting costs will vary anywhere between $5-$25 a month. But with dedicated hosting, the costs could be very high in the range between $300-$350 a month. If you need additional resources, then you need to pay extra for dedicated hosting. But if you are a large enterprise or have a website with huge traffic, shared hosting is not an option.
Even though you need to know how to copy/move files around, everything is configured with shared hosting. All you need to do is move your files to the server, and you are done with the hosting. It is the hosting company that takes care of installing the OS, software, etc. Hence, you don’t need to have much technical knowledge when it comes to shared hosting.
With dedicated hosting, you will be allotted a separate server, and you will have complete control over the server. If there are any issues with the server, you will need to check and resolve them. Hence, technical knowledge of handling and maintaining a server is required if you opt for dedicated hosting.
Shared Hosting vs Dedicated Hosting – Final Thoughts
Choosing a web hosting service is an important decision you take for a hassle-free website experience. The right hosting service will give you good performance and speed to your website. While shared hosting is a cheaper option than dedicated hosting, it has its own advantages and disadvantages. Dedicated hosting is the best choice if you don’t care about the budget. Read hosting reviews to understand the various hosting services before you come to an informed decision. It all depends on the requirements of your website and the budget allotted for hosting etc. Please share your comments and suggestions in the feedback section below. Stay Safe!